2. Explore communicable and non-communicable disease

Mission Objectives

Understand the difference between communicable and non-communicable diseases

Identify examples of communicable and non-communicable diseases

Understand how the spread of communicable diseases can be prevented

Understand the impact of non-communicable diseases on health and well-being

Keywords

Words and meanings to learn

symptom

Evidence of disease that indicates the presence of being poorly.

gonorrhoea

A sexually transmitted disease.

salmonella

A bacteria best known for being a cause of diarrhoea.

prevention

The act or practice of keeping something from happening.

virus

A tiny, infectious particle that lives inside of living organisms.
